``` // 全局通用日志工具 function setlog($param = [],$result = [],$name='',$filename = 'm.log',$path = '/tmp/bear/'){ // 没有目录则创建目录 if (!mkdir($path, 0777, true) && !is_dir($path)) { throw new \...
原创 2021-08-05 15:31:53
124阅读
PHP堆栈跟踪(php stack trace) Nginx日志追踪一: 错误代码页面:
原创 2021-06-04 23:20:23
155阅读
error_log('你要输出的信息', 3, 'E:\work\jiajiayue\Application\Api\Controller\1.txt');die; php error_log记录日志的使用方法和配置 对于PHP开发者来 说,一旦某个产品投入使用,应该立即将 display_erro
原创 2021-05-26 17:47:55
1019阅读
PHP是一种广泛应用的服务器端脚本语言,常用于开发动态网站和网页应用程序。Linux是一种开源操作系统,广泛用于服务器端应用。在PHP和Linux的应用中,日志是一项非常重要的功能。日志记录了系统的运行状态、错误信息和用户操作等,有助于系统管理员快速定位和解决问题。 在PHP应用开发中,日志记录是一项至关重要的工作。通过记录日志,开发人员可以了解到系统运行过程中的问题和异常,从而及时修复bug和
原创 7月前
19阅读
对于PHP开发者来说,一旦某个产品投入使用,应该立即将 display_errors选项关闭,以免因为这些错误所透露的路径、数据库连接、数据表等信息而遭到黑客攻击。但是,任何一个产品在投入使用后,都难 免会有错误出现,那么如何记录一些对开发者有用的错误报告呢?我们可以在单独的文本文件中将错误报告作为日志记录。错误日志的记录,可以帮助开发人员或者 管理人员查看系统是否存在问题。 如果需要将
PHP堆栈跟踪(php stack trace)PHP message: PHP Stack trace:PHP message: PHP 1. {main}() /home/www/ford4s/public/index.php:0PHP message: PHP 2. AMAI\Application->run() /home/www/ford4s/pu...
原创 2023-02-21 09:47:26
92阅读
$filedir = "../runtime/log/"; is_dir($filedir) ?: mkdir($filedir, 0777, true); $file = $filedir.date("YmdHi").'log.txt'; $content = " ".date("Y-m-d H:
php
原创 2022-05-02 15:41:57
212阅读
$basePath = dirname(__File__); file_put_contents($basePath.'./11.log',var_export(11,true));
php
原创 2022-07-22 15:00:05
68阅读
PHP 5.6... 运算符定义变长参数函数 ... 运算符进行参数展开** 进行幂运算use function 以及 use const__debugInfo()PHP 5.5.0     新增 Generators     新增 finally 关键字     foreach 现在支持 list()&nb
原创 2014-09-25 21:29:45
246阅读
PHP 5.6    ... 运算符定义变长参数函数     ... 运算符进行参数展开    ** 进行幂运算    use function 以及 use const    __debugInfo()PHP 5.5.0   
原创 2014-09-25 21:31:58
382阅读
PHP-FPM的错误日志建议打开,这样可以看到PHP的错误信息:一般是这个配置路径 /etc/php/7.3/fpm/pool.d/www.conf,日志目录如果需要自己建立PHP目录,一定要把权限赋给www-data用户,否则没有创建目录的权限,就无法记录日志chown www-data:www-
PHP
原创 2021-06-17 19:18:51
1192阅读
$file ){ $rows[$file]['cnt']++; $rows[$file]['size']=$matches[2][$key];}arsort($rows);$i=0;$t = 0;foreach( $rows as $file=>$row ){ $size = $row['cnt']*$row['size']; $r[$file] = getMbps($si...
转载 2007-06-26 17:18:00
102阅读
默认是以本机的安装路径cd /usr/local/php/etc/vim php-fpm.conf; The log file for slow requests; Default Value: not set; Note: slowlog is mandatory if request_slowl...
转载 2014-09-19 11:53:00
135阅读
2评论
/** * 写日志,方便测试(看网站需求,也可以改成把记录
原创 2022-06-06 18:41:35
91阅读
PHP开发中,日志记录是非常重要的一环,通过记录日志可以帮助开发者在程序出现异常时快速定位问题并进行排查。而在Linux系统中,使用Red Hat Enterprise Linux(RHEL)操作系统的用户可以通过Red Hat提供的系统日志服务——syslog,来方便地记录PHP应用程序的日志信息。 在使用PHP编写的应用程序中,通常会使用PHP自带的error_log函数来记录日志信息。该
原创 6月前
39阅读
在进行Web开发的过程中,宝塔面板是一个非常方便的工具,宝塔面板支持多种操作系统,其中就有Linux系统。在Linux系统上面,我们经常会使用PHP来编写Web应用程序,而记录应用程序运行情况的日志则显得尤为重要。因此,本文将介绍如何在宝塔面板上配置PHP日志相关的内容。 首先,在宝塔面板上安装好PHP后,我们需要进入PHP的配置页面。在宝塔面板上,选择对应的站点,点击“设置”按钮,然后选择“P
原创 7月前
226阅读
需求:找到访问小图最多的前三个ip, 日志文件20121030.log 0    192.168.1.102    small_0.gif 1    192.168.1.113    big_1.gif 2    192.168.1.110&
原创 2012-11-14 00:52:47
906阅读
概要:php中的错误日志,可以保存在本地,也可以保存在远程目录,下面我们以保存在本地为例子。php错误日志保存相关函数:error_log($mes,$mes_type,$destination)其中$mes_type=3说明,错误日志是追加写入文件,而不是覆盖原文件案例1:<?php date_default_timezone_set("Asia/Chongqing"); function
原创 2016-05-21 20:30:06
905阅读
1点赞
A lesser known trick is that mod_php maps stderr to the Apache log. And, there is a stream for that, so file_put_contents('/path/to/file.log', $foo .
转载 2016-04-05 18:01:00
215阅读
PHP简单封装个打印日志类,方便查看日志: 在指定的路径下可以通过tail -f命令查看日志文件内容。 调用方法:
PHP
原创 2021-07-29 17:56:11
625阅读
  • 1
  • 2
  • 3
  • 4
  • 5